# FakeAI
> *The AI is fake. The API is fake. The responses are fake. But your code? That's real. Or is it? Welcome to the simulation.*

FakeAI simulates the complete OpenAI API, as well as numerous NVIDIA AI services (NIM, AI-Dynamo, DCGM, Cosmos) with instant feedback and reproducible results. Develop and optimize your applications locally with realistic service behavior, then deploy to production infrastructure when ready.

## Quick Start

### Installation

```bash
pip install fakeai
```

### Start Server

```bash
# Basic startup (localhost:8000)
fakeai server

# Custom configuration
fakeai server --port 9000 --host 0.0.0.0

# Zero latency for maximum throughput
fakeai server --ttft 0 --itl 0
```

### Use with OpenAI SDK

```python
from openai import OpenAI

client = OpenAI(
    api_key="any-key-works",
    base_url="http://localhost:8000"
)

# Chat completion
response = client.chat.completions.create(
    model="openai/gpt-oss-120b",
    messages=[{"role": "user", "content": "Hello!"}]
)
print(response.choices[0].message.content)

# Streaming
stream = client.chat.completions.create(
    model="openai/gpt-oss-120b",
    messages=[{"role": "user", "content": "Count to 10"}],
    stream=True
)
for chunk in stream:
    print(chunk.choices[0].delta.content, end="", flush=True)
```

### AI-Dynamo

**Advanced KV cache management and smart routing**

**Features:**
- **Radix Tree Prefix Matching** - SGLang-style efficient prefix matching
- **Block-level Caching** - Configurable block size (default: 16 tokens)
- **Multi-worker Simulation** - Simulates distributed workers
- **Smart Request Routing** - Cost-based routing with cache overlap scoring
- **Prefix Caching** - Automatic shared prompt detection
- **Cache Metrics** - Hit rates, token reuse, overlap statistics

**Configuration:**
```bash
export FAKEAI_KV_CACHE_ENABLED=true
export FAKEAI_KV_CACHE_BLOCK_SIZE=16
export FAKEAI_KV_CACHE_NUM_WORKERS=4
export FAKEAI_KV_OVERLAP_WEIGHT=1.0
fakeai server
```

**Metrics:**
```bash
curl http://localhost:8000/kv-cache/metrics
```

**Benefits:**
- Realistic TTFT speedup on cache hits (60-80% reduction)
- Simulates cache warming and reuse patterns
- Worker load balancing with cache affinity

### Cosmos

**Video understanding and token calculation**

**Features:**
- **Video Token Calculation** - Resolution, duration, FPS-aware
- **Frame Extraction** - Configurable frame sampling
- **Multi-modal Input** - Video + text in chat completions
- **Detail Levels** - Auto, low, high with token scaling
- **URL Metadata** - Extract video metadata from URLs

**Example:**
```python
response = client.chat.completions.create(
    model="nvidia/cosmos-vision",
    messages=[{
        "role": "user",
        "content": [
            {"type": "text", "text": "Describe this video"},
            {"type": "video_url", "video_url": {
                "url": "https://example.com/video.mp4?width=512&height=288&duration=5.0&fps=4"
            }}
        ]
    }]
)
```

**Token Calculation:**
- Base tokens: 85
- Per-frame tokens: 10-50 depending on resolution and detail level
- Total = base + (frames × tokens_per_frame)

### Latency Profiles

**37+ model-specific latency profiles with realistic TTFT/ITL**

Pre-configured profiles for:
- GPT-4, GPT-4o, GPT-3.5 Turbo
- Llama 3, Llama 3.1, Llama 3.2 (8B, 70B, 405B)
- DeepSeek-V3, DeepSeek-R1
- Mixtral 8x7B, 8x22B
- Claude 3.5 Sonnet, Claude 3 Opus
- And 20+ more...

**Dynamic Adjustments:**
- Prompt length affects TTFT
- KV cache hits reduce TTFT by 60-80%
- Concurrent load adds queuing delays
- Temperature affects generation speed
- Model size scales latency

### Error Injection

**Configurable failure simulation for testing**

```bash
export FAKEAI_ERROR_INJECTION_ENABLED=true
export FAKEAI_ERROR_INJECTION_RATE=0.15  # 15% error rate
export FAKEAI_ERROR_INJECTION_TYPES='["internal_error", "service_unavailable"]'
fakeai server
```

**Error Types:**
- `internal_error` (500)
- `bad_gateway` (502)
- `service_unavailable` (503)
- `gateway_timeout` (504)
- `rate_limit_quota` (429)
- `context_length_exceeded` (400)

## Configuration

### Environment Variables

```bash
# Server
FAKEAI_HOST=0.0.0.0                    # Server host
FAKEAI_PORT=8000                       # Server port
FAKEAI_DEBUG=false                     # Debug mode

# Authentication
FAKEAI_REQUIRE_API_KEY=true            # Require API key
FAKEAI_API_KEYS=key1,key2,key3         # Comma-separated keys
FAKEAI_HASH_API_KEYS=false             # SHA-256 hashing

# Timing
FAKEAI_TTFT_MS=20                      # Time to first token (ms)
FAKEAI_TTFT_VARIANCE_PERCENT=10        # TTFT variance (%)
FAKEAI_ITL_MS=5                        # Inter-token latency (ms)
FAKEAI_ITL_VARIANCE_PERCENT=10         # ITL variance (%)

# KV Cache (AI-Dynamo)
FAKEAI_KV_CACHE_ENABLED=true           # Enable KV cache
FAKEAI_KV_CACHE_BLOCK_SIZE=16          # Block size (tokens)
FAKEAI_KV_CACHE_NUM_WORKERS=4          # Simulated workers
FAKEAI_KV_OVERLAP_WEIGHT=1.0           # Cache overlap weight

# Rate Limiting
FAKEAI_RATE_LIMIT_ENABLED=false        # Enable rate limiting
FAKEAI_RATE_LIMIT_TIER=tier-1          # Tier (tier-1 through tier-5)
FAKEAI_RATE_LIMIT_RPM=500              # Requests per minute
FAKEAI_RATE_LIMIT_TPM=10000            # Tokens per minute

# Error Injection
FAKEAI_ERROR_INJECTION_ENABLED=false   # Enable error injection
FAKEAI_ERROR_INJECTION_RATE=0.0        # Error rate (0.0-1.0)

# Security
FAKEAI_ENABLE_ABUSE_DETECTION=false    # Enable abuse detection
FAKEAI_ENABLE_INPUT_VALIDATION=false   # Enable input validation

# CORS
FAKEAI_CORS_ALLOWED_ORIGINS=*          # Allowed origins
FAKEAI_CORS_ALLOW_CREDENTIALS=true     # Allow credentials
```

### CLI Options

```bash
fakeai server --help

Options:
  --host TEXT              Server host (default: 0.0.0.0)
  --port INTEGER           Server port (default: 8000)
  --debug                  Enable debug mode
  --ttft FLOAT             Time to first token in ms (default: 20)
  --itl FLOAT              Inter-token latency in ms (default: 5)
  --require-api-key        Require API key authentication
  --api-keys TEXT          Comma-separated API keys
  --kv-cache-enabled       Enable KV cache simulation
  --rate-limit-enabled     Enable rate limiting
```

## Use Cases

### Development

```bash
# Start with zero latency for fast iteration
fakeai server --ttft 0 --itl 0

# Test your application
python my_app.py
```

### Testing

```python
import pytest
from openai import OpenAI

@pytest.fixture
def client():
    return OpenAI(api_key="test", base_url="http://localhost:8000")

def test_chat_completion(client):
    response = client.chat.completions.create(
        model="openai/gpt-oss-120b",
        messages=[{"role": "user", "content": "Test"}]
    )
    assert response.choices[0].message.content
```

### CI/CD Integration

```yaml
# .github/workflows/test.yml
name: Test
on: [push]
jobs:
  test:
    runs-on: ubuntu-latest
    steps:
      - uses: actions/checkout@v3
      - name: Start FakeAI
        run: |
          pip install fakeai
          fakeai server --ttft 0 --itl 0 &
          sleep 5
      - name: Run tests
        run: pytest tests/
```
